About this property
Klee House is a contemporary two-storey residence that exemplifies modern architectural design. Originally designed in 1959 by renowned architect Ian Preston and thoughtfully extended in 2004 by the award-winning John Pardey Architects. This home now features five elegant bedrooms in the main house and a separate two-bedroom annexe, both enjoying fantastic far-reaching views.

Location
Little Kingshill is a village within the Chilterns National Landscape and has a primary school, The Full Moon public house, playing fields, Priestfield Arboretum and a Baptist Church which is home to the Kingshill Kitchen Café. Great Missenden (1.8 miles) has a wider range of amenities including restaurants, a supermarket, boutique shops and a Post Office.
The nearby A413 links Amersham (Metropolitan/Chiltern Line) about 5 miles and Great Missenden (Chiltern Line) about 1.5 miles.
The area is renowned for its excellent educational facilities including Dr Challoner's Grammar School in Amersham and Dr Challoner's High School in Little Chalfont and Chesham Grammar School.
